> I found Eskil's patch to use less overhead and be a cleaner
> implementation than MythStream, but without the ability to play some
> of the more obscure streaming stations that MythStream can play. My
> biggest problem with MythStream is it doesn't seem to be able to use
> the built in visualizations but its own which ends up eating most of
> my Athlon64's CPU power to show me a frequency bar graph. If Eskil
> updated his patch to play things like Live365 streams and similar then
> I'd say that would be the hands down winner.

I'll second that - I see that when I use MythStream to listen to
Realplayer streams it uses ffmpeg rather than needing the Real plugin so
presumably that could be lifted from mplayer and put into MythMusic as
well.
